Building Owners & Management Agents – Earn Advertising Revenue

Building Banners Ltd is looking for new building banner sites in the following locations: London, Birmingham, Manchester, Leeds, Liverpool & Glasgow *media banners need to be visible to a large audience of pedestrians and / or motorists, either in a top city centre location or overlooking a major arterial road or motorway route!     …

Read More

Giant Media UK Ltd, 58 Chapletown Road, Radcliffe, Manchester, M26 1YF.
Terms of Use | Privacy Policy All rights reserved ©‎ 2020 | Built by Think Zap